Kaj je datotečni sistem in katere so različne vrste?
Računalniki uporabljajo določene vrste datotečnih sistemov za shranjevanje in organiziranje podatkov na medijih, kot je npr trdi disk oz bliskovni pogon, ali CD-ji, DVD-ji in BD-ji v optični pogon.
Datotečni sistem si lahko predstavljamo kot indeks ali bazo podatkov, ki vsebuje fizično lokacijo vsakega podatka na napravi. Podatki so običajno organizirani v mape, imenovane imeniki, ki lahko vsebujejo druge mape in datoteke.
Vsako mesto, kjer računalnik ali druga elektronska naprava shranjuje podatke, uporablja nekakšen datotečni sistem. To vključuje vaš računalnik z operacijskim sistemom Windows, vaš Mac, vaš pametni telefon, bankomat vaše banke – celo računalnik v vašem avtomobilu!
Datotečni sistemi Windows
Microsoft Windows operacijski sistemi so vedno podpirali različne različice FAT datotečni sistem. FAT pomeni Tabela za dodelitev datotek, izraz, ki opisuje, kaj počne: vzdržuje tabelo dodelitve prostora vsake datoteke.
Poleg FAT vsi operacijski sistemi Windows od Windows NT podpirajo novejši datotečni sistem, imenovan
Podpirajo tudi vse sodobne različice sistema Windows exFAT, ki je zasnovan za bliskovne pogone.
ReFS (Resilient File System) je novejši datotečni sistem za Windows 11, 10 in 8, ki vključuje funkcije, ki niso na voljo pri NTFS, vendar je trenutno omejen na več načinov. Ogledate si lahko, katere različice sistema Windows podpirajo vsako različico ReFS v tej tabeli.
Datotečni sistem je nastavljen na pogonu med a formatu. Glej Kako formatirati trdi disk za več informacij.
Več o datotečnih sistemih
Datoteke na napravi za shranjevanje so shranjene sektorji. Sektorji, označeni kot neuporabljeni, lahko shranjujejo podatke, običajno v skupinah imenovanih sektorjev blokov. To je datotečni sistem, ki določa velikost in položaj datotek ter kateri sektorji so pripravljeni za uporabo.
Sčasoma, zaradi načina, kako datotečni sistem shranjuje podatke, povzroča zapisovanje in brisanje iz naprave za shranjevanje razdrobljenost zaradi vrzeli, ki neizogibno nastanejo med različnimi deli datoteke. A brezplačen pripomoček za defragmentacijo lahko pomaga popraviti.
Brez strukture za organiziranje datotek ne bi bilo le skoraj nemogoče odstraniti nameščene programe in pridobiti določene datotek, vendar ne moreta obstajati dve datoteki z istim imenom, ker je vse lahko v isti mapi (kar je eden od razlogov, da so mape tako uporabno).
Kar pomenijo datoteke z istim imenom, je na primer slika. Datoteka IMG123.jpg lahko obstaja v več sto mapah, ker se vsaka mapa uporablja za ločevanje datoteke, tako da ni konflikta. Vendar pa datoteke ne morejo imeti enakega imena, če so v istem imeniku.
Datotečni sistem ne shranjuje samo datotek, temveč tudi informacije o njih, kot so velikost sektorskega bloka, informacije o fragmentih, velikost datoteke, lastnosti, ime datoteke, lokacijo datoteke in hierarhijo imenika.
Nekateri operacijski sistemi, razen Windows, prav tako izkoriščajo prednosti FAT in NTFS, vendar je na obzorju operacijskega sistema veliko vrst datotečnih sistemov, kot je HFS+, ki se uporablja v izdelku Apple, kot sta iOS in macOS. Wikipedia ima obsežen seznam datotečnih sistemov če te bolj zanima tema.
Včasih se izraz "datotečni sistem" uporablja v kontekstu predelne stene. Če na primer rečete "na mojem trdem disku sta dva datotečna sistema" ne pomeni, da je pogon razdeljen med NTFS in FAT, ampak da obstajata dve ločeni particiji, ki uporabljata isti fizični disk.
Večina aplikacij, s katerimi pridete v stik, za delovanje potrebuje datotečni sistem, zato ga mora imeti vsaka particija. Prav tako so programi odvisni od datotečnega sistema, kar pomeni, da programa v sistemu Windows ne morete uporabljati, če je bil ustvarjen za uporabo v macOS-u.